We can say that the television schedule will shift temporarily on Monday, ‘15 June’ and Tuesday ‘16 June’. The evening broadcast will move over to BBC Two at the traditional time of 7: 30pm. Meanwhile, the remaining chapters will return to BBC One on Wednesday and Thursday.
However, it will be at a significantly delayed slot of 8: 30 pm. Soap’s executive producer Ben Wadey previously dropped hints regarding these imminent casting surprises. And now it’s verified that a highly familiar face will officially step back.
